Surf VPNs and Smart VPNs are extremely important for safe and private browsing. VPNs, or Virtual Private Networks, establish a secure network from a common online interface. VPNs mask your internet protocol (IP) address, making it significantly harder to track your internet activities. Furthermore, they offer increased protection for your digital information which is absolutely critical in the current era of widespread internet usage.
